0
ファイル: CLS_Compiler.cs プロジェクト: kkndest/fightclub
        ICLS_Expression OptimizeSingle(ICLS_Expression expr, CLS_Content content)
        {
            if (expr is CLS_Expression_Math2Value || expr is CLS_Expression_Math2ValueAndOr || expr is CLS_Expression_Math2ValueLogic)
            {
                if (expr.listParam[0] is ICLS_Value &&
                    expr.listParam[1] is ICLS_Value)
                {
                    CLS_Content.Value result = expr.ComputeValue(content);
                    if (result.type == typeof(bool))
                    {
                        CLS_Value_Value <bool> value = new CLS_Value_Value <bool>();
                        value.value_value = (bool)result.value;
                        value.tokenBegin  = expr.listParam[0].tokenBegin;
                        value.tokenEnd    = expr.listParam[1].tokenEnd;
                        return(value);
                    }
                    else
                    {
                        ICLS_Type  v     = content.environment.GetType(result.type);
                        ICLS_Value value = v.MakeValue(result.value);
                        value.tokenBegin = expr.listParam[0].tokenBegin;
                        value.tokenEnd   = expr.listParam[1].tokenEnd;

                        return(value);
                    }
                }
            }
            if (expr is CLS_Expression_Math3Value)
            {
                CLS_Content.Value result = expr.listParam[0].ComputeValue(content);
                if (result.type == typeof(bool))
                {
                    bool bv = (bool)result.value;
                    if (bv)
                    {
                        return(expr.listParam[1]);
                    }
                    else
                    {
                        return(expr.listParam[2]);
                    }
                }
            }

            return(expr);
        }

0
        public virtual bool MathLogic(CLS_Environment env, logictoken code, object left, CLS_Content.Value right)
        {
            System.Reflection.MethodInfo call = null;

            //var m = type.GetMethods();
            if (code == logictoken.more)//[2] = {Boolean op_GreaterThan(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_GreaterThan");
            }
            else if (code == logictoken.less)//[4] = {Boolean op_LessThan(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_LessThan");
            }
            else if (code == logictoken.more_equal)//[3] = {Boolean op_GreaterThanOrEqual(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_GreaterThanOrEqual");
            }
            else if (code == logictoken.less_equal)//[5] = {Boolean op_LessThanOrEqual(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_LessThanOrEqual");
            }
            else if (code == logictoken.equal)//[6] = {Boolean op_Equality(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                if (left == null || right.type == null)
                {
                    return(left == right.value);
                }
                call = type.GetMethod("op_Equality");
            }
            else if (code == logictoken.not_equal)//[7] = {Boolean op_Inequality(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                if (left == null || right.type == null)
                {
                    return(left != right.value);
                }
                call = type.GetMethod("op_Inequality");
            }
            var obj = call.Invoke(null, new object[] { left, right.value });

            return((bool)obj);
        }

0
        public virtual object Math2Value(CLS_Environment env, char code, object left, CLS_Content.Value right, out Type returntype)
        {
            returntype = type;
            System.Reflection.MethodInfo call = null;
            //var m = type.GetMethods();
            if (code == '+')
            {
                call = type.GetMethod("op_Addition", new Type[] { this.type, right.type });
            }
            else if (code == '-')//base = {CLScriptExt.Vector3 op_Subtraction(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_Subtraction", new Type[] { this.type, right.type });
            }
            else if (code == '*')//[2] = {CLScriptExt.Vector3 op_Multiply(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_Multiply", new Type[] { this.type, right.type });
            }
            else if (code == '/')//[3] = {CLScriptExt.Vector3 op_Division(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_Division", new Type[] { this.type, right.type });
            }
            else if (code == '%')//[4] = {CLScriptExt.Vector3 op_Modulus(CLScriptExt.Vector3, CLScriptExt.Vector3)}
            {
                call = type.GetMethod("op_Modulus", new Type[] { this.type, right.type });
            }
            var obj = call.Invoke(null, new object[] { left, right.value });

            //function.StaticCall(env,"op_Addtion",new List<ICL>{})
            return(obj);
        }
